Horse Nation-True Stories about Horses and People by Teresa Tsimmu Martino;The horses are blessed, chosen by God." Teresa Martino took the words her father whispered to her as a child to heart, and for more than 40 years has lived and worked with horses, hearing their stories and learning their lessons. In Horse Nation, she tells of the heroes and the fallen, the defiant and the healers, the gentle pony and the angry stallion: Casey, the blood bay, who jumped a teenage girl over her mother's car in a rite of passage; Icy, a black mare, strong and independent, who embodied the circle of life; and The Corinthian, a gray gelding, defining what it means to be a champion. She writes also of the riders, grooms, coaches, and students who have walked and breathed the equine path like acolytes. Martino's poems and sketches further illuminate this lyrical exploration of the unique relationship between horse and human. Paperback. 192 pg.
